The user is often warned to expect their antivirus software to flag the crack as a threat and is instructed to add it to the antivirus’s exceptions list. Legitimate software never requires you to disable your core security defenses. When a crack "injects" or "manipulates" code into a running process—as the forum user describes—it is engaging in behavior identical to that of many types of malware and viruses.
